Essential Cooking Tools

Cooking tools are a vital part of the culinary experience. They can help you prepare and cook food more effectively, ensuring that your dishes turn out just as you imagined. Here are some essential cooking tools:

Knives

A good set of knives is a must-have for any kitchen. Knives come in various shapes and sizes, each designed for specific tasks. Some common types of knives include:

  • Chef's Knife: A versatile all-purpose knife suitable for chopping, mincing, and slicing.
  • Paring Knife: Small and agile, perfect for peeling, trimming, and slicing small fruits and vegetables.
  • Bread Knife: Wide and serrated, ideal for cutting through crusty bread and other dense, layered foods.

Cutting Boards

Cutting boards are used to protect your countertops from knife damage and to prevent cross-contamination of flavors and germs between foods. Common materials for cutting boards include plastic, wood, and bamboo.

Mixing Bowls

Mixing bowls are used for preparing and mixing ingredients. They come in various sizes and are often made from materials like glass, stainless steel, or plastic.

Pots and Pans

Pots and pans are essential for cooking and baking. Different shapes and materials are used for specific cooking techniques. Some common types include:

  • Saucepan: A small, shallow pan with a thick bottom, used for cooking sauces and boiling small quantities of liquids.
  • Frying Pan: A flat, wide pan used for sautéing, pan-frying, and searing ingredients.
  • Stockpot: A large, deep pot used for making soups, stews, and boiling large quantities of water or other liquids.

Utensils

Cooking utensils help you mix, stir, and serve food. Some common utensils include:

  • Spatula: A flat, wide tool used for spreading and scraping ingredients.
  • Whisk: A tool with thin wires used for incorporating air into ingredients, like eggs or cream.
  • Ladle: A long-handled spoon used for serving soups, sauces, and stews.
  • Tongs: A versatile tool used for flipping food, stirring ingredients, or serving food.

Measuring Cups and Spoons

Measuring cups and spoons are essential for following recipes accurately. They come in various sizes and are often made from plastic or metal.

Food Processor

A food processor is a versatile appliance that can chop, slice, shred, and puree ingredients. It's perfect for making sauces, dips, and doughs.

Blender

A blender is a powerful appliance used for blending ingredients, often for smoothies, soups, and sauces. It can also be used for grinding nuts and ice.

Oven Mitts and Potholders

Oven mitts and potholders protect your hands from hot surfaces and pots. They come in various materials like silicone, cotton, and wool.

Colander

A colander is a perforated tool used for rinsing and draining ingredients, like pasta or vegetables.

Thermometer

A thermometer is used to measure the temperature of foods, ensuring they are cooked to the desired level of doneness.

Baking Sheets and Pans

Baking sheets and pans are used for baking cookies, making bread, and roasting vegetables. They come in various sizes and materials, like aluminum or baking stone.

Grater

A grater is a tool used for shredding, slicing, or mincing ingredients like cheese, vegetables, or chocolate.

Peeler

A peeler is a handheld tool used for removing the skin from fruits and vegetables.

Can Opener

A can opener is a simple tool used for opening cans of food.

Dutch Oven

A Dutch oven is a heavy, cast-iron pot with a tight-fitting lid, used for cooking stews, braises, and bread.

Wok

A wok is a Chinese cooking pan with a rounded bottom, used for stir-frying and other Asian-style cooking techniques.

Skewers

Skewers are used for grilling or broiling small pieces of food, like kebabs or shish kebabs.
